As a Concierge, you will ensure that the lobby, entry ways and front desk are clean and organized at all times; sign for deliveries and packages; and accept service requests from residents. Your responsibilities will also include contacting emergency services in the event of an emergency, monitoring visitor parking and handling noise complaints from residents.
Primary Job Responsibilities:
- Maintain an excellent customer service relationship by adhering to the Capitol Concierge Inc. standards
- Adhere to the CCI Standard Operating Procedures
- Ensuring the lobby, entry ways, and front desk is clean and organized at all times
- General housekeeping tasks: dusting, cleaning glass doors, sweeping entryways, etc.
- Maintain any Community Refreshment Areas: coffee, water, continental breakfast, etc.
- Perform Receptionist duties including: answering the telephone, providing information, forwarding calls and taking messages when necessary
- Routinely inspect community amenity areas for trash, cleanliness, and lighting
- Signing for deliveries and packages and tracking on the community Package Log
- Distributing and assisting residents with packages
- Accepting service requests from residents and logging appropriately
- Ensuring that all apartment keys are accounted for and secure during shift per Access Management standards
- When necessary, issuing keys to residents or other associates.
- Monitoring visitor parking areas and issuing parking passes (if applicable)
- Receive and distribute dry cleaning to residents (if applicable)
- Track, monitor and inspect amenity areas when rented by residents
- Handle noise complaints presented by residents after normal leasing office business hours
- Contact emergency services in the event of a fire or other incident requiring fire, medical, or police attention
